Background: Acute myeloid leukaemia (AML) is a common and aggressive haematological neoplasm. Limited studies of AML in South Africa have shown differences in age at diagnosis and overall survival (OS) compared to international studies. Aim: To determine the demographics, subtype and OS of AML. Setting: The study was conducted at the National Health Laboratory Service at Tygerberg Hospital, Cape Town, South Africa. Methods: Patients with newly diagnosed AML from 2015 to 2018 were identified. The diagnostic subtype and prognostic group for each AML was determined. Survival analysis was performed. Results: Ninety patients were included. The median age of adults was 54 years (interquartile range [IQR] 38 years – 65 years, n = 77), and for children was 2 years (IQR 2 years – 7 years, n = 13). The male-to-female ratio was 1:1.4. Acute promyelocytic leukaemia (21%) and AML myelodysplasia related (19%) were the commonest subtypes. The 3-year OS in children, adults < 60 years and adults ≥ 60 years was 46%, 21% and 3%, respectively. Adverse risk group increased risk of death (p = 0.003, n = 38). Age, white cell count and platelet count were independent risk factors for death. Conclusion: In contrast to high-income countries, our findings show a younger age at AML diagnosis, a female predominance and a lower OS. Age and full blood count (FBC) parameters are important predictors for OS. Contribution: The findings complement other studies published in South Africa, showing younger age at diagnosis and inferior OS of AML, while highlighting the importance of FBC findings.
